Paths of Light
Originally released in 2005. Paths of Light is a drama film. directed by Attila Mispál.
Starring Anna Marie Cseh, György Cserhalmi, and Attila Soós
Synopsis
Two stories running in parallel: In one, a model is surrounded by men wanting to use and abuse her though, without realizing it, she is protected by a strange tramp guardian angel. In the other, a blind goldsmith struggles to produce his latest commission in the midst of his alcoholism and depression. Both then descend further and further into their own personal hells until they finally re-find peace with themselves and then their stories briefly merge.
